| Because of the higher ground clearance, Volkswagen Up! can perform better on bad roads - it can go over higher obstacles and bumps. At the same time, the higher ground clearance can reduce stability and handling on paved roads, especially at higher speeds. Note, however, that this Volkswagen Up! version does not have 4x4 drive, which is very important in poor road conditions. | |||
